Web1821: Francesco Carlini made pendulum observations on top of Mount Cenis, Italy, from which, using methods similar to Bouguer's, he calculated the density of the Earth. You will have to convert kilometers, km, (for the diameter) to meters by multiplying the number of … WebThe gravity on Mars is 3.711 m/s², which is just 38 percent the gravity on Earth. Earth’s gravity is 9.807 m/s², compared to the moon’s gravity of 1.62 m/s² or just 17 percent of Earth’s gravity. Spanning hundreds of …
